Как работать с файловой системой на Android: особенности и советы

Управление файлами на устройствах Android может вызвать некоторые трудности. Аппараты с этой операционной системой используют свой собственный интерфейс для работы с файловой системой, который может отличаться от привычных для пользователей ПК. Важно понимать, как происходит работа с файлами на Android и какие технологии могут помочь в этом процессе.

Когда дело доходит до работы с файлами, на Android есть несколько способов. Один из них — использование встроенного менеджера файлов. Есть также множество приложений, которые могут помочь в этом деле. Все они имеют особенности и недостатки, и выбор нужного варианта зависит от личных потребностей пользователя.

Одним из советов по работе с файловой системой Android является использование облачных хранилищ. Многие облачные сервисы, такие как Google Drive, Dropbox и OneDrive, предоставляют возможность хранить и синхронизировать файлы на устройствах Android. Такой подход позволяет не только облегчить доступ к файлам, но и резервировать их важную информацию.

Содержание

Работа с файловой системой на Android: советы и особенности

Работа с файлами на Android

Для работы с файлами на Android необходимо знать основные особенности файловой системы операционной системы. Android использует файловую систему ext4, которая наиболее распространена в Unix-подобных операционных системах. В Android файловая система разделена на несколько разделов, каждый из которых имеет свою функцию.

Советы по работе с файловой системой

  • Сохраняйте данные в уникальный каталог: для каждого приложения должен быть создан свой уникальный каталог для хранения данных. Это поможет избежать конфликтов и потерь данных.
  • Используйте ContentProvider: для доступа к общим данным, например, контактам или календарю, следует использовать ContentProvider. Это поможет избежать проблем с правами доступа к данным других приложений.
  • Ограничивайте доступ к файловой системе: защитите свои данные, ограничивая доступ к файловой системе. Не давайте ненужным приложениям доступ к данным других приложений.

Особенности файловой системы

В Android файловая система разделена на несколько разделов с различными функциями:

  • system: содержит основные компоненты операционной системы
  • data: предназначен для хранения данных приложений
  • cache: используется для временных файлов приложений
  • sdcard: монтируется в качестве внешнего накопителя и использования внешних карт памяти

Знание особенностей файловой системы Android поможет разработчикам создавать более надежные и безопасные приложения.

Зачем нужно знать, как работать с файловой системой на Android?

Работа с файлами является одним из базовых навыков, необходимых в современных технологиях. И на Android-устройствах это не исключение.

Понимание того, как работает файловая система на Android, может быть полезным для решения различных задач, таких как создание и хранение файлов, работы с различными форматами файлов или передачей данных между приложениями.

Кроме того, знание особенностей работы с файловой системой может помочь улучшить безопасность вашего устройства.

  • Знание, как работать с файловой системой, позволяет установить правильные настройки доступа к файлам и убедиться, что только нужные приложения имеют доступ к конфиденциальным данным.
  • Некоторые приложения могут работать с файлами без вашего ведома. Знание, как контролировать доступ к файлам и какие файлы создают и используют приложения, поможет вам управлять этим процессом.

В целом, знание, как работать с файловой системой на Android, может быть полезным как для повседневного использования устройства, так и для более продвинутых технических действий.

Особенности файловой системы Android

Android – это операционная система, которая используется на большинстве мобильных устройств в мире. Работа с файлами на Android может быть немного сложнее, чем на обычном компьютере, поэтому важно знать ее особенности и использовать соответствующие технологии.

Одна из основных особенностей файловой системы Android – это использование виртуальной файловой системы. Она позволяет устройству логически объединять и управлять файлами и данными в компактной форме. Кроме того, на Android-устройствах может быть несколько файловых систем, например, таких как FAT32 или exFAT.

Читать еще:   Как сбросить блокировку Google на Android: Простые способы

Другая важная особенность файловой системы Android – это разделение доступа к файлам между приложениями. Каждое приложение имеет свою собственную папку, которая не доступна другим приложениям без специальных разрешений. Это повышает безопасность и защиту данных пользователей, но также затрудняет работу с файлами.

Советы по работе с файловой системой Android.

  • Используйте специальные библиотеки и встроенные функции для работы с файлами, такие как FileProvider, Document Provider, Storage Access Framework (SAF) и др.
  • Будьте осторожны с удалением файлов и папок. Удаление системных файлов может привести к неполадкам устройства.
  • Для сохранения данных используйте SharedPreferences или SQLite. Эти технологии знают, как работать с файловой системой Android и сохранять их в удобном и безопасном формате.
  • Не храните большое количество данных вложенных друг в друга. Это может привести к замедлению работы и к неожиданным сбоям.

Как использовать файловые менеджеры на Android?

Работа с файлами на Android является обычной задачей для пользователей. Но проще с этой задачей справляться с помощью файловых менеджеров. Такие приложения позволяют осуществлять наиболее важные и необходимые функции при работе с файлами на устройстве.

Советы по использованию файловых менеджеров:

  1. Выберите приложение под свои нужды. Существует огромное количество файловых менеджеров на рынке, так что выбирайте то приложение, которое больше всего удовлетворяет вашим потребностям и личным предпочтениям.
  2. Используйте функцию поиска. Если у вас много файлов на устройстве, то поиск в приложении может сэкономить время и помочь найти нужный файл.
  3. Автоматизируйте процесс синхронизации. Синхронизация файлов с облачными сервисами может занимать много времени. Вы можете автоматизировать процесс, выбрав определенные файловые менеджеры, которые поддерживают автоматическую синхронизацию.

Технологии, используемые в файловых менеджерах, могут значительно отличаться от приложения к приложению, но, как правило, они используют стандартные функции системы Android. Используемые технологии могут включать основные элементы пользовательского интерфейса, системные API, различные библиотеки и фреймворки.

Как эффективно работать с хранилищем на Android?

Работа с файлами

Одной из основных задач для разработчика Android приложений является работа с файлами. При этом необходимо учитывать, что файловая система на Android довольно специфична и имеет некоторые особенности.

Технологии

Для эффективной работы с файловой системой Android можно использовать различные технологии. Например, можно использовать ContentProvider для доступа к файлам и данным, хранящимся в БД. Также можно использовать библиотеки для работы с файлами, такие как Okio и Apache Commons IO.

Файловая система

Файловая система на Android использует формат yaffs2, что может оказаться сложным для использования на некоторых устройствах. Однако, для работы с файлами и хранилищами на Android можно использовать различные API, такие как Storage Access Framework и MediaStore API.

Советы

  • Для безопасной работы с файлами на Android лучше использовать специальные библиотеки, которые позволяют работать с файлами и данными безопасно.
  • Не стоит забывать про возможные проблемы с доступностью хранилищ на некоторых устройствах.
  • Необходимо учитывать особенности работы с файлами на различных версиях Android.

Как распознать и устранить проблемы с файловой системой на Android?

Работа с файлами на Android может столкнуть вас с некоторыми проблемами, связанными с файловой системой. Они могут вызвать некорректную работу приложений или потерю данных

Ошибки, связанные с файловой системой

Одной из распространенных проблем является несовместимость файловой системы с технологиями, используемыми в приложениях. Это может привести к ошибкам при чтении или записи данных.

Проблемы могут также возникать из-за неправильной монтировки файловой системы или из-за повреждения файловых системных структур. Это может привести к потере или повреждению важных данных.

Устранение проблем

Если у вас возникли проблемы с файловой системой на Android, вам следует принять несколько мер для их устранения.

В первую очередь вы можете попробовать перезагрузить устройство. Возможно некоторые мелкие проблемы с файловой системой могут быть устранены таким способом.

Если перезагрузка не помогает, воспользуйтесь программами для проверки целостности файловой системы. Эти программы могут сравнивать файловую систему с нормальным состоянием, чтобы обнаружить и устранить ошибки.

Если ничего не помогает и проблема остается, то вам следует обратиться к специалистам по ремонту мобильных устройств для решения проблемы.

  • Перезагрузите устройство
  • Воспользуйтесь программами для проверки целостности файловой системы
  • Обратитесь к специалистам по ремонту мобильных устройств

Создание и редактирование файлов на Android

Технологии контроля над файловой системой на Android позволяют пользователям создавать и редактировать файлы на мобильных устройствах. Для этого можно использовать как встроенные средства Android, так и сторонние приложения.

Советы по работе с файлами на Android позволят упростить процесс создания и редактирования файлов. Например, для создания нового файла стоит использовать наиболее подходящий формат, чтобы файл отображался на устройстве корректно. Также стоит учитывать ограничения по размеру файлов и использовать специальные программы для компрессии файлов, если необходимо сохранить большой объем информации.

  • Для редактирования файлов на Android можно использовать специальные текстовые редакторы, которые поддерживают различные форматы файлов.
  • Также для редактирования графических файлов можно использовать специальные редакторы изображений, которые позволяют изменять яркость, контрастность и насыщенность изображений.
Читать еще:   Почему Android лучше для гейминга: исследование производительности и графики

Таким образом, работа с файлами на Android требует определенных знаний и навыков. Однако, благодаря широкому выбору приложений и программ, пользователи могут легко и удобно создавать и редактировать файлы на мобильных устройствах.

Установка и удаление приложений на Android через файловую систему

Работа с файловой системой является важным элементом в технологиях Android. С ее помощью можно установить новые приложения и удалить ненужные.

Чтобы установить приложение через файловую систему, необходимо скачать файл APK установщика. Этот файл можно загрузить через браузер или скопировать на устройство через кабель USB.

После этого необходимо найти файл с помощью файлового менеджера и запустить его. Система попросит разрешение на установку приложения, после чего оно будет установлено на устройство.

Чтобы удалить приложение через файловую систему, необходимо найти папку, где хранятся установленные приложения и удалить оттуда файл APK.

Удаление приложения через файловую систему не удаляет данные, связанные с приложением, такие как настройки или кеш. Чтобы полностью удалить приложение, нужно воспользоваться меню настройки приложений в системе Android.

Использование облачных хранилищ в современных технологиях Android

В современном мире все больше пользователей сталкиваются с бесконечным ростом количества информации, которую необходимо хранить и передавать. В таких условиях, использование облачных хранилищ становится необходимым в сфере современных технологий. Как использовать облачные хранилища вместе с файловой системой Android?

  • Выбор облачного хранилища. В первую очередь, стоит выбрать облачное хранилище, которое соответствует потребностям пользователя. Стоит учитывать такие факторы, как объем бесплатного пространства, уровень безопасности и доступность для синхронизации с файловой системой Android;
  • Работа с облачным хранилищем в Android. После выбора подходящего облачного хранилища, необходимо скачать приложение на свое устройство. Для многих облачных хранилищ существует отдельное приложение для Android, которое облегчает синхронизацию и работу с файлами;
  • Интеграция облачного хранилища с файловой системой Android. После скачивания и установки приложения для облачного хранилища на устройстве, необходимо произвести процесс интеграции. Как правило, процедура интеграции заключается в вводе логина и пароля для доступа к облачному хранилищу. После этого, можно использовать облачное хранилище вместе с файловой системой Android.

Как видно из вышеприведенных советов, использование облачных хранилищ вместе с файловой системой Android является вполне реальным процессом, который не требует значительных затрат времени и ресурсов. Главное следовать простым инструкциям и выбрать облачное хранилище, которое будет соответствовать потребностям пользователя.

Как сделать резервное копирование файлов и данных на Android?

Файловая система на Android

Android — это операционная система, на которой работают миллионы мобильных устройств по всему миру. В основе Android лежит файловая система, которая позволяет управлять всеми файлами на устройстве. В операционной системе присутствуют средства для работы с файлами и папками, а также множество технологий для управления ими.

Работа с файлами на Android

Работа с файлами на Android является довольно простой. Android имеет встроенные инструменты для создания, редактирования, копирования и перемещения файлов. Система также имеет возможность создания резервных копий файлов и данных, что является очень важным для сохранения данных на устройстве.

Как сделать резервное копирование файлов и данных на Android

Существует несколько способов сделать резервную копию файлов и данных на Android. Один из самых простых способов — использование стороннего приложения для создания резервной копии. Существуют множество приложений для этого, некоторые из которых предлагают как бесплатную, так и платную версию. Эти приложения могут создавать резервные копии файлов, контактов, календаря и других данных на устройстве.

Еще один способ сделать резервное копирование данных — использование встроенных средств Android. Для этого нужно зайти в настройки устройства и в разделе «Общие» выбрать «Резервирование и сброс». В этом разделе Вы можете выбрать, какие данные и файлы нужно скопировать на Google Диск или на очень надежный сервер. В этом случае, для резервного копирования служит Google аккаунт, который связывает ваше устройство с облачным сервисом.

Итак, сделать резервное копирование файлов и данных на Android совсем не сложно. Для этого можно использовать как сторонние приложения, так и встроенные инструменты операционной системы. Главное – не забывать делать бэкап данных регулярно, чтобы защитить себя от потери важной информации.

Как работать с USB-хранилищем на Android?

Файловая система Android имеет множество технологий для удобной работы с файлами на устройствах. Одна из таких технологий — работа с USB-хранилищем.

Для начала работы с USB-хранилищем, необходимо подключить устройство к телефону или планшету при помощи USB-кабеля. После этого, появится уведомление, в котором можно выбрать опцию «Передача файлов». После этого, USB-хранилище будет установлено на телефоне и будет доступно для использования.

При работе с файлами на USB-хранилище, необходимо учитывать, что некоторые файлы могут быть недоступны из-за прав доступа.

Многие пользователи используют USB-хранилища для передачи файлов с компьютера на телефон или планшет. Это очень удобно, так как нет необходимости использовать сетевое соединение.

Кроме того, можно создавать резервные копии на USB-накопителях, что важно для сохранения личной информации.

Читать еще:   Голосовой поиск на Android: 5 лучших аналогов Siri для поиска телефона и планшета

В заключение, используя USB-хранилища на Android устройстве возможна удобная и быстрая работа с файлами.

Как повысить безопасность данных на Android в процессе работы с файловой системой?

Android — это мощная и удобная операционная система, которая имеет широкие возможности работы с файлами. Однако, при работе с файловой системой могут возникнуть проблемы с безопасностью данных. В этом случае нужно принимать меры для защиты информации.

Советы для безопасной работы с файлами на Android:

  • Храните файлы в защищенных папках: Используйте файловые менеджеры, которые позволяют создавать пароли на папки или блокировать их доступ. Это поможет защитить ваши файлы от несанкционированного доступа.
  • Регулярно делайте бэкапы: Чтобы не потерять важную информацию, регулярно создавайте бэкапы важных файлов и сохраняйте их на отдельных внешних носителях. В случае утери данных можно будет их восстановить.
  • Не храните конфиденциальную информацию на устройстве: Если у вас есть конфиденциальная информация, которая может принести вред в случае ее утечки, то не храните ее на устройстве. Используйте пароли на документы и сохраняйте их на защищенных облачных хранилищах.
  • Устанавливайте только проверенные приложения: Загрузка приложений из непроверенных источников может привести к установке вредоносных программ, которые могут проникнуть в вашу файловую систему и нанести вред информации. Устанавливайте только проверенные приложения из Google Play и других доверенных источников.
  • Сразу удаляйте ненужные файлы: Старайтесь не оставлять на устройстве ненужные файлы. Чем меньше файлов на устройстве — тем меньше вероятность их утечки. Периодически проверяйте папки на наличие ненужных файлов и удаляйте их.

Вопрос-ответ:

Как сохранить файл на внутреннюю память устройства?

Для сохранения файла на внутреннюю память устройства необходимо получить доступ к объекту Context и использовать метод getFilesDir(), который возвращает путь к директории, доступной только для приложения.

Как сохранить файл на внешнюю SD-карту?

Для сохранения файла на внешнюю SD-карту необходимо получить разрешение на запись в хранилище внешней памяти, а затем использовать метод getExternalFilesDir() или getExternalStoragePublicDirectory() для получения пути к директории.

Как получить список файлов в директории?

Для получения списка файлов в директории можно использовать метод listFiles() класса File, который возвращает массив файлов, находящихся в данной директории.

Как удалить файл?

Для удаления файла необходимо создать объект класса File, представляющий данный файл, а затем вызвать метод delete() этого объекта.

Что такое URI и как его использовать для работы с файлами?

URI — это универсальный идентификатор ресурса, который состоит из схемы (например, file://), имени хоста и пути к ресурсу. URI можно использовать для получения доступа к файлам и директориям, как на локальном устройстве, так и на удаленном сервере.

Как работать с внешним хранилищем?

Для работы с внешним хранилищем необходимо получить разрешение на доступ к нему, а затем использовать классы MediaStore или DocumentFile для получения доступа к файлам и директориям в нем.

Какие особенности работы с файловой системой Android нужно учитывать?

Одной из особенностей работы с файловой системой Android является то, что в некоторых версиях операционной системы нужно запросить разрешение на запись во внешнее хранилище у пользователя. Также необходимо учесть, что различные устройства могут иметь разные доступные пути к директориям. Кроме того, следует помнить о том, что файлы и директории могут иметь ограничения доступа в зависимости от уровня разрешений, установленных в приложении, что может приводить к ошибкам в работе приложения.

Можно ли работать с файловой системой без разрешения пользователя?

Нет, работа с файловой системой требует разрешения пользователя для каждого приложения. Это необходимо для защиты данных пользователя.

Lopatniki.ru
Добавить комментарий